Output 508983f34b925a50714bc41236c97179b0cf8b3165b782cc958416a2d0d268b5:1

value
196252004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 520b6a771389f51a93edd89d9c8f4592bbf79a39 OP_EQUALVERIFY OP_CHECKSIG
address
18Up5vKYQrQ3ESjQZKQ63N689Ph6TKgz5z
transaction
508983f34b925a50714bc41236c97179b0cf8b3165b782cc958416a2d0d268b5
spent
true